If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your iPhone or iPad.
Tap on your Apple ID at the top of the screen.
Select Subscriptions.
Find and tap on the Trout Unlimited subscription.
Scroll down and tap on Report a Problem.
Choose Your subscription billing – I want a refund.
In the comments, mention that the subscription renewed without notice and that you would like a refund.
Submit your request.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store app.
Tap the menu icon (three horizontal lines) in the top left corner.
Select Subscriptions.
Find your Trout Unlimited subscription and tap on it.
Tap on Cancel subscription (if required).
Return to the Play Store menu and select Account.
Scroll down to Purchase history, locate the Trout Unlimited transaction, and tap on it.
Select Report a Problem and then Request a refund.
In the text box, mention that the service was not used and state your refund request.
Submit your request.
